FactionVisits
This mod adds visual icons to help you coordinate who your teammates are going to target
Fork of TOSTeamVisitsIcons by pokegustavor
Features
Role Revival Icon
Allows you to enable the ability to show the icon of roles been revived by your retri or necromancer, for example if your Necromance revives a Werewolf to visit someone, you will see a Werewolf icon on that person.
Day Ability Icons
Allows you to enable the ability to show the icons of your teammates' Day abilites, for example if you have a Jailor on your team, there will be an icon on who they select to be Jailed furing the day.
Does not add icons for instant abilities (revealing, meteor, etc.)
Display Mode
Allows you to switch how the icons from your teammates' regular abilites will be shown, the options are:
- Role Icon: You will see the role icon of your teammates, with exceptions made for roles that can target multiple people (Seer, Witch, Necromancer, etc.)
- Ability Icon: The icon of the ability your teammate is using will be shown
- No Icon: No icon will be added for your teammates action. Necronomicon and special abilities still appear as normal
Book Icon
Allows you to switch how the Necronomicon icon appears.
- Replace Icon: Will replace the ability/role icon with the Necronomicon
- Add Icon: Will add the Necronomicon icon next to the default ability/role icon
- No Icon: Never show the Necronomicon icon
Special Ability Icon
Allows you to switch how your teammates' special abilities appear.
- Add Icon: Will add the special ability icon next to the default ability/role icon
- Replace Icon: Will replace the ability/role icon with the special ability icon
- No Icon: Never show special ability icons
Show Own Actions
Allows you to enable the ability to add icons for your own actions
- Never: Never add icons for your own actions
- Only as Factional Evil: Only add icons when you play as a factional evil (Coven, Apocalypse, Vampire, Cursed Souls)
- Always: Always add icons for your own actions
Handle Overcharges
Allows you to enable the ability for the mod to try handle overcharged teammates properly.
- Only Myself: Only handle when you're overcharged
- All Teammates (EXPERIMENTAL): Handle all teammate's overcharges. Experimental, as there's no 100% way to tell if someone else is actually overcharged
- Never: Never handle overcharges
